SUMMARY OF WORK
The interior partial renovations of a 8,230 SF space within a 16,180 gsf +/- existing medical building. Renovations include work to be phased in 2 split phases where +/- half of the renovation space will be operated by the owner. Renovations include selective demolition, new finishes and paint, new toilet room configurations, new casework and front desk, HVAC upgrades including new RTU, electrical modifications, new FA in the warehouse.
